A Reticulated Copper-decorated Brush Holder
Joseon dynasty (late 19th century)
Cylindrical, on an inset, short foot and pierced with four svastika medallions, each colored with copper-red underglaze, and the entire vessel save the unglazed foot rim applied with a glossy clear glaze of bluish tinge, the brush holder additionally incised with foliate borders around each of the four windows and with double-lines at the base and lip
4 5/8in. (11.6cm.) high; 4 3/8in. (11.2cm.) diameter
